The rollout of the National Home Safety Service by the National Collective of Women's Refuges begins today (1 July 2015).
The National Collective was awarded the $3.6 million contract by the Ministry of Justice in March. It will run for three years commencing in Auckland, Tauranga and Christchurch as part of a staged national roll-out.
When fully operating, the service will help up to 400 victims of family violence a year, and up to 600 children, to remain in their homes with a significantly reduced risk of serious physical harm or violence.
